Transaction 0805d5ec24f1b818855017d14021de63fbcb8f1e7476127dea64c459e20ffa4f

1 Input
1 Outputs
  • 0805d5ec24f1b818855017d14021de63fbcb8f1e7476127dea64c459e20ffa4f:0
  • value  125315
    address  2NAuUpwa8MGSd58sQj4vkZ3ieeDyoAD1vjb